The Importance Of Kunstversicherung In Protecting Valuable Art Pieces

Kunstversicherung, which translates to art insurance in English, is a crucial aspect of safeguarding valuable art pieces from potential risks and uncertainties. For both private collectors and institutions, investing in art insurance can provide peace of mind and financial protection in the event of theft, damage, or loss. In this article, we will delve into the importance of Kunstversicherung and why it is essential for anyone who owns valuable works of art.

Art insurance is a specialized form of insurance that is designed to protect art collectors, museums, galleries, and other art-related businesses from potential financial loss. The art market is a high-value industry, with millions of dollars being exchanged for rare and valuable art pieces. As such, the stakes are high when it comes to protecting these investments. Kunstversicherung provides coverage for a variety of risks, including theft, damage, vandalism, and even natural disasters.

One of the primary reasons why Kunstversicherung is essential is the uncertainty and unpredictability of the art market. Art pieces can be subject to a wide range of risks, including theft by burglars or dishonest employees, damage during transit or while on display, or even loss due to fire, flooding, or other natural disasters. Without proper insurance coverage, the financial impact of such events can be devastating for both individuals and institutions.

Moreover, art insurance can also provide coverage for restoration and conservation costs. In the event that an art piece is damaged or deteriorates over time, art insurance can help cover the expenses associated with restoring the piece to its original condition. This is particularly important for collectors who own valuable or irreplaceable artworks, as restoration costs can be substantial.

Another benefit of Kunstversicherung is the liability coverage it provides. In the event that someone is injured while on the premises of a museum, gallery, or private collector, art insurance can help cover the costs of legal fees and settlements. This can protect individuals and institutions from potential lawsuits and financial liabilities that may arise from accidents or injuries involving art pieces.

For private collectors, Kunstversicherung can also provide coverage for loans and temporary exhibitions. When lending art pieces to museums or galleries, it is essential to ensure that the pieces are adequately insured in case of loss or damage during transport or while on display. Art insurance can provide the necessary coverage to protect the collector’s investment and ensure that the art piece is safeguarded in all circumstances.
